Инструменты пользователя

Инструменты сайта


установка_на_rocky_8

**Это старая версия документа!**

Установку будем производить на Rocky Linux 8

систему будем разворачивать на 3 ноды

node1 192.168.30.32 master node2 192.168.20.33 node3 192.168.30.34

Добавим репозиторий(на всех нодах)

dnf config-manager –add-repo=https://download.docker.com/linux/centos/docker-ce.repo

dnf install containerd

dnf install docker-ce –nobest -y

systemctl start docker

Change docker to use systemd cgroup driver.

echo '{

"exec-opts": ["native.cgroupdriver=systemd"]

}' > /etc/docker/daemon.json

systemctl restart docker

k8s

vi < /etc/yum.repos.d/kubernetes.repo

[kubernetes] name=Kubernetes baseurl=https://packages.cloud.google.com/yum/repos/kubernetes-el7-$basearch enabled=1 gpgcheck=1 repo_gpgcheck=1 gpgkey=https://packages.cloud.google.com/yum/doc/yum-key.gpg https://packages.cloud.google.com/yum/doc/rpm-package-key.gpg exclude=kubelet kubeadm kubectl

dnf install -y kubelet kubeadm kubectl –disableexcludes=kubernetes

systemctl enable kubelet

systemctl start kubelet

На master node

kubeadm config images pull

kubeadm init –pod-network-cidr 192.168.0.0/16

если не работает закомментить в vim /etc/containerd/config.toml запрещенные плагины т перезапустить systemctl restart containerd

установка_на_rocky_8.1711218298.txt.gz · Последнее изменение: 2024/03/23 18:24 — kirill

DokuWiki Appliance - Powered by TurnKey Linux